HALE HOMESTEAD APARTMENTS is one of 1,316 community water systems in Michigan in the 500 or fewer people size category, serving 72 people from groundwater.

As of August 1, 2026, its federal record holds 10 entries between 2004 and 2025, all of which EPA lists as closed.

Of the 10, 8 are monitoring and reporting requirements — the category that accounts for about four in five of all violations in EPA's national dataset — rather than findings about the water itself. The record involves the Total Coliform Rules, the Groundwater Rule, and the Consumer Confidence Rule.

What is a Consumer Confidence Report?

A Consumer Confidence Report (CCR) is the annual drinking water quality report that community water systems must provide to the people they serve. It lists the contaminants detected in the system’s water during the year, where the water comes from, and how the results compare with federal limits. EPA’s revised CCR rule takes effect January 1, 2027, and the first reports in the new format are due July 1, 2027.
